It is now common for a university student to own the latest iPhone 15 Pro Max not because they are rich, but because they are leveraging a 12-month installment plan that eats 40% of their monthly allowance from their parents. This creates a culture of (theatre)—looking rich while eating instant noodles for the rest of the month. The hustle culture is real: Gen Z is obsessed with side hustles (jualan online, dropshipping, or becoming a content creator ) specifically to pay off their Cicil debts.
